Lancashire return to Emirates Old Trafford looking to consolidate momentum after three wins in their last four matches. The narrow one‑run loss to Nottinghamshire last time out should sharpen their death-overs execution.

Derbyshire arrive searching for stability after a sequence featuring a tie and three defeats in five. The recent four-run home loss to Lancashire adds extra edge to this rematch under Manchester lights.

Lancashire vs Derbyshire Head-to-Head Record

Lancashire have dominated this fixture, winning all five recorded meetings against Derbyshire. The margins have often been decisive, including wins by 80, 57, and 42 runs, with the latest a tight four-run result. The long-term trend clearly favors Lancashire, who have handled Derbyshire’s attack and contained their batting consistently across venues.

LAN vs DER Team Previews

Lancashire

Lancashire’s batting is powered by Liam Livingstone, who pounded 74 off 43 against Leicestershire and 85 off 31 against Durham. He also adds utility with the ball, taking wickets in three of his last five outings. Keaton Jennings offers stability at the top, striking 42 off 29 in the one‑run defeat to Nottinghamshire.

The bowling unit is humming. Jack Blatherwick has taken two wickets in each of his last three appearances. Tom Aspinwall delivered 2 wickets in the recent win at Derby and chipped in across games. Luke Wood has struck in three straight matches, while Tom Hartley continues to control the middle overs with regular wickets.

Derbyshire

Derbyshire’s batting has seen sparks without consistency. Wayne Madsen hit 62 off 33 in the tie against Yorkshire, while Ross Whiteley slammed 46 off 29 in the narrow loss to Lancashire. Martin Andersson’s late-order hitting remains a factor after 69 off 43 and 51 off 27 in earlier matches.

With the ball, Ben Aitchison has been their most reliable threat, returning 3 wickets against Yorkshire and striking in each of his last five listed games. Matthew Montgomery offers part-time breakthroughs, taking wickets in three consecutive outings before the Lancashire clash. The attack still seeks a collective surge in powerplay and death phases.

Pitch Report and Weather Conditions

Emirates Old Trafford typically offers pace and bounce with grip for spinners as the game wears on. With both seam and spin in play, powerplay wickets are crucial before the surface eases for stroke-making. A par first-innings total shapes around the mid‑160s, with 180+ giving the batting side a commanding platform if set smartly.
